Text

(a)Kerosene and motor fuels conveyed for consumption in Tennessee shall be labeled and posted in accordance with applicable federal and state law.
(b)Kerosene and motor fuels conveyed for consumption in Tennessee shall meet the standards established for such products in the annual book of ASTM standards, and supplements thereto; provided, that by duly promulgated rule:
(1)The department may adopt alternative volatility standards for gasoline-alcohol blends; provided, that the alternative standards are consistent with the protection and promotion of public health, safety and welfare; and (2) The department shall adopt as a substitute standard any provision of federal law which imposes requirements in conflict with an ASTM standard.

Legislative History

Amended by 2017 Tenn. Acts, ch. 106, s 1, eff. 4/7/2017. Acts 1989, ch. 397, § 4; 1997 , ch. 40, § 1; 2005, ch. 2, § 1.
